The AC Milan jersey is a type of jersey that is worn by the players of AC Milan Football Club. The jerseys are highly fashionable, and many people wear them regardless of whether they support the club or play the game. The jerseys are available in four main types. These jerseys include the home jersey, the away jersey, the third jersey, and the goalkeeper's jersey. Each jersey has its unique features and designs.
Home Jersey
The AC Milan home jersey is worn during home games. It is designed with the team's traditional colors, red and black stripes. The colors are a symbol of the club's identity and heritage. The home jersey is stylish and designed for comfort and performance. The jersey is made from lightweight and breathable fabric. The fabric helps in moisture-wicking and keeps the players dry and cool on the pitch. The design also features the club's crest and sponsor logos. The design is incorporated seamlessly into the overall aesthetic of the jersey. It is a representation of the team's pride and history.
Away Jersey
The away jersey is typically of a different color from the home jersey. It is designed to be worn during away games. The AC Milan away jersey has a different design and color scheme from the home jersey. It is often more neutral. For instance, white or black is commonly used. Just like the home jersey, it is developed with performance-enhancing technology. It keeps the players dry and comfortable. The away jersey also features the club's crest and sponsor logos. They are incorporated in a way that complements the overall design of the jersey.
Third Jersey
The third jersey is an alternative kit worn when both the home and away jerseys clash with the opposing team's colors. The AC Milan third jersey usually features a unique and stylish design. It is a reflection of contemporary fashion trends and technological advancements. The third jersey retains the performance features of the other jerseys. For instance, moisture-wicking fabric and breathability. The jersey also has the club's crest and sponsor logos that are integrated into its design.
Goalkeeper Jersey
The AC Milan goalkeeper jersey is specifically designed for the team's goalkeepers. It usually has long sleeves. The jersey is padded in areas that are mostly prone to impact. For instance, the elbows and shoulders. The design also features bright and contrasting colors. This is a deliberate choice to distinguish the goalkeeper from the other players. The jersey incorporates advanced materials. The materials provide comfort and flexibility. They also allow for easy movement and breathability. This enables the players to perform optimally.
The AC Milan jerseys are designed with a blend of traditional symbolism and modern functionality to reflect the club's rich heritage and the dynamic nature of contemporary football. Below are the key design aspects of the jerseys;
Symbolism and Colors
The jerseys AC Milan home jersey design prominently features red and black vertical stripes, a classic symbol of the club that represents passion (red) and strength (black). The home jersey typically retains this iconic pattern, which is instantly recognizable and steeped in history. The away jersey, on the other hand, often takes a more understated approach, frequently appearing in white or a light color, sometimes accented with subtle stripes or patterns in red and black to maintain a connection to the home design.
Fit and Fabric Technology
Modern AC Milan jerseys are crafted with advanced fabric technology to enhance player performance. The fit is usually athletic, tailored to provide maximum mobility without being restrictive. Fabrics commonly incorporate moisture-wicking properties to keep players dry and comfortable by efficiently managing sweat absorption and evaporation. This technology helps maintain optimal body temperature and reduces chafing, allowing players to perform at their best for extended periods.
Details and Accents
Details play a crucial role in the AC Milan jerseys, adding both aesthetic and symbolic elements. The club's iconic crest, featuring the cross of St. George and the Milan coat of arms, is prominently displayed on the chest, representing the club's rich history and identity. Additional accents may include sponsorship logos, which are strategically placed to maintain balance and visual appeal. Other elements, such as championship stars above the crest, signify the club's numerous victories and prestigious achievements in football, adding a layer of heritage and pride to the jersey's design.
Collar and Cuffs
The collar and cuffs of the AC Milan jerseys are designed to enhance both style and functionality. The home jersey typically features a classic polo-style collar, which may include subtle ribbing or piping in complementary colors like black or red. This adds a touch of elegance while maintaining a sporty look. Cuffs on the sleeves often mirror the collar in design, providing a cohesive and polished appearance. For the away jersey, the collar design may vary, sometimes adopting a V-neck with a minimalist aesthetic, ensuring comfort and ease of movement without compromising style.

Q1: What materials are used to make AC Milan jerseys?
A1: The jerseys are made of high-quality, breathable fabric. This includes polyester and cotton blends. These materials are chosen for their durability and comfort.
Q2: How can one tell if an AC Milan jersey is authentic?
A2: Authentic jerseys have specific characteristics. They include high-quality stitching, clear logos, and tags. Also, the fabric feels different and the overall quality is better.
Q3: Are there different jerseys for home and away games?
A3: Yes, there are. The home jerseys usually feature the team's traditional colors. On the other hand, the away jerseys have different colors and designs.
Q4: How should one care for an AC Milan jersey?
A4: To maintain the jersey, it should be washed in cold water. Also, users should avoid tumble drying and bleach. Furthermore, it should be air dried and ironed on low heat.
Q5: Are there jerseys for AC Milan women and kids?
A5: Yes, there are. They come in various sizes and designs that fit different age groups and genders. Moreover, they retain the same quality as the men's jerseys.
